Mine stopped at 4.2.2.2.
I'm also enjoying the car, but have experienced a couple of issues. I've had trouble with phone calls unless it's through Android auto. Even then, I've had some crackling audio quality.
I don't like how the home screen just shows the available apps. The home screen on my wife's BMW X3 hybrid shows current nav, music selected, and connected phones, all on a much smaller display. I would like to be able to have a split screen between the nav display and the media that is playing. I can do that in Android auto, but not when using the in-built nav.
With texts, I get a beep when one comes in, but don't seem to have a way to access it through the car's system. In Android auto, I can have it read out, and I can reply by voice.
There's a distinct whistling noise from the car at about 30-35 mph.
